How they compare
Latvia currently reports 54.1% against 53.8% in Slovakia, a difference of 0.3%.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 12 shared years of data; in 2013 it was Slovakia ahead.
Latvia ranks 25th and Slovakia ranks 27th of 169 countries.
Slovakia has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
